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education Salary in the United States

Median annual wage: $38,140 · Median hourly: $18.34 · Employment: 478,780

Annual Salary Percentiles

PercentileAnnualHourly
10th$28,990$13.94
25th$34,530$16.60
Median$38,140$18.34
75th$47,550$22.86
90th$61,390$29.52

For career planning: entry-level pay (10th percentile) is about $28,990, median pay is $38,140, and experienced pay (90th percentile) reaches $61,390.

Pay spans a wide range: workers at the 10th percentile earn about $28,990, while those at the 90th percentile earn about $61,390 — a 2.1x gap between entry-level and top earners.

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education Salary by State

The table below ranks every state by median annual wage. Click a state for detailed local data.

StateMedian AnnualMedian Hourlyvs NationalEmployment
Alabama $28,310 $13.61 -25.8% 7,910
Alaska $46,130 $22.18 +20.9% 520
Arizona $36,300 $17.45 -4.8% 9,400
Arkansas $34,190 $16.44 -10.4% 3,270
California $47,400 $22.79 +24.3% 55,700
Colorado $45,500 $21.87 +19.3% 5,210
Connecticut $45,740 $21.99 +19.9% 5,230
Delaware $36,360 $17.48 -4.7% 2,000
District of Columbia $62,150 $29.88 +63.0% 2,350
Florida $35,860 $17.24 -6.0% 35,740
Georgia $43,920 $21.12 +15.2% 16,850
Hawaii $48,780 $23.45 +27.9% 1,410
Idaho $32,800 $15.77 -14.0% 1,010
Illinois $40,910 $19.67 +7.3% 22,420
Indiana $36,650 $17.62 -3.9% 7,110
Iowa $33,830 $16.26 -11.3% 5,910
Kansas $47,750 $22.96 +25.2% 1,330
Kentucky $29,780 $14.32 -21.9% 8,520
Louisiana $38,020 $18.28 -0.3% 3,570
Maine $43,890 $21.10 +15.1% 1,110
Maryland $44,600 $21.44 +16.9% 8,020
Massachusetts $45,890 $22.06 +20.3% 18,710
Michigan $37,110 $17.84 -2.7% 10,950
Minnesota $43,430 $20.88 +13.9% 10,320
Mississippi $36,250 $17.43 -5.0% 3,600
Missouri $36,090 $17.35 -5.4% 5,580
Montana $36,540 $17.57 -4.2% 960
Nebraska $47,040 $22.62 +23.3% 1,630
Nevada $38,870 $18.69 +1.9% 2,360
New Hampshire $39,350 $18.92 +3.2% 2,220
New Jersey $48,220 $23.19 +26.4% 16,190
New Mexico $44,070 $21.19 +15.5% 2,490
New York $46,520 $22.37 +22.0% 23,870
North Carolina $35,710 $17.17 -6.4% 18,370
North Dakota $39,720 $19.10 +4.1% 540
Ohio $35,180 $16.91 -7.8% 19,840
Oklahoma $31,790 $15.29 -16.6% 7,010
Oregon $45,140 $21.70 +18.4% 6,300
Pennsylvania $36,050 $17.33 -5.5% 22,760
Rhode Island $36,830 $17.71 -3.4% 1,890
South Carolina $34,500 $16.59 -9.5% 4,550
South Dakota $44,500 $21.39 +16.7% 1,470
Tennessee $34,280 $16.48 -10.1% 5,420
Texas $33,860 $16.28 -11.2% 41,200
Utah $35,010 $16.83 -8.2% 3,670
Vermont $49,730 $23.91 +30.4% 940
Virginia $37,140 $17.86 -2.6% 13,570
Washington $45,660 $21.95 +19.7% 13,210
West Virginia $32,480 $15.62 -14.8% 2,190
Wisconsin $36,160 $17.39 -5.2% 11,330
Wyoming $29,930 $14.39 -21.5% 1,040

Data source: BLS OES state file · U.S. BLS OES, May 2024 (updated April 2025)

How many preschool teachers, except special education are employed in the U.S.?

There are approximately 478,780 preschool teachers, except special education employed nationally, per BLS OES.
